
Stephen Percy "Steve" Harris (born 12 March 1957) is an English musician and songwriter, known as the bassist, occasional keyboardist, backing vocalist, leader, and primary songwriter of the British heavy metal band Iron Maiden, which he founded as a teenager in 1975. He and Dave Murray are the only original members of the band to have appeared on all of the band's albums, but Murray joined the band in 1976, making Harris the only person who has been a member of Iron Maiden since their inception. He used to work as an architectural draftsman in the East End of London but gave up his job upon forming Iron Maiden. During the mid-1970s, he was a youth team footballer for West Ham United. He still is a talented amateur football player and often has the crest of West Ham on his bass, and he has stated his first ambition in life before music was to become a professional footballer.
